Kyra went to get off her horse only for Mikasa to look at her. "No, you don't. Get back on the horse Kyra." Mikasa warned riding right next to her and grabbing her hood.

"Mika, I appreciate your concern, but it's fine. It's only a scratch, I can move around just fine." Kyra reassured only for Mikasa to grip her hood tighter.

"It's not just a scratch. Get back on the horse before I make you." Mikasa said glaring at her sternly.

Kyra was about to protest until a horse came up to her other side walking past them before stopping. Captain Levi turned his head glancing at Kyra.

His eyes narrowed into a glare at her. "And what did I just say earlier, Kyra? Let me tell you since you seem to have forgotten. You are not to move from that horse. Your back took a nasty hit and you need to limit your movements. That is unless you want to join Jaeger on the wagon." Captain Levi said sternly causing Kyra to look at him with narrowed eyes.

Kyra stayed there glaring at him as he glared back. Kyra huffed in agitation caving to his orders. The girl had a recoil of an attitude, trust issues, and lacked any respect for authority. Luckily, the man understood where she was coming from and knew just how to go about it to make her follow orders.

She had posed a major problem in the trust aspect, but he didn't have to worry as much, because she was quick to act and think before others, sharp instincts, and could make judgment calls on the whim. And to top it all off, she had a selfless mentality. Meaning she would put others before her in these situations unless she was ordered differently.

So while she may not trust people as a whole, she did trust their abilities to an extent, since they were in the Scouts for a reason and have survived this long. She didn't underestimate them like they had certainly have done with her.

Kyra grumbled under her breath as she moved back on the horse. "Whatever you say, mother."

Mikasa looked over at Kyra observing her as a question popped into her mind. She understood that she wasn't going to tell them about her back so she wouldn't bother asking about the scars.

Another question did arise though. How had she been able to take the Female Titan by surprise? How was she able to sneak up without being seen or heard? Mikasa glanced at her before speaking.

"Kyra, how were you able to sneak up on the Female Titan?" Mikasa asked.

Kyra turned glancing at Mikasa pressing her lips together in thought. "By using my surroundings to my advantage. I purposely didn't use my ODM and chose to free fall. She has keen hearing. I noticed with each reinforcement she didnt have a view on she was still able to strike them because she heard them. The sound would've been enough to give my position away if I had used the gear, so I opted not to use it. It's the same way, I conserve my gas. Back in Trost while everyone was almost empty, I still had plenty left. It's not because I sat back or used it sparingly. It's because I moved without it. I'm sure you've noticed but when all of you move using your ODM gear, I choose to run across the roof and jump to another. It goes without saying, that I don't recommend anyone to take up this method, because it is risky. And I'm not sure if they would react quick enough to catch themselves, if they missed a step. But there you have it. No special technique or power, just reckless and risky maneuvers. That's all." Kyra explained.

Mikasa glanced at her with wide eyes before she closed her eyes thinking back to Trost and then with the Female Titan. A memory appeared from five years ago of Kyra climbing on buildings and jumping from roof to roof.

No, it's not like anybody else can pull it off. The fact is that, she is the only one who can actually do that. No one else would even be able to make the jump. Many would fall short and many more wouldn't be able to react quick enough. There's also the fact that no one would willingly dive off a roof or tree from that height and trust themselves to act quickly.

She knew what she was capable of and trusted herself and her skills to a high degree. She was fearless. She held no doubts in her skills and it shows. Her instincts are well-tuned and sharp.

She opened her eyes glancing back to Kyra, "I see. It makes sense, now that I think about it. That's always something that you were able to do as a kid. And honestly, I think you are probably the only one who could do that, ability wise. I know I wouldn't be able to." Mikasa informed.

Kyra closed her eyes nodding. That's probably for the best.

Mikasa left to go check up on Eren as Kyra looked around solemnly.

"Kyra, are you okay?" Armin asked standing next to her horse.

Kyra looked down at Armin as he looked at the bandaged around her back.

"Yeah, what the hell happened to you?" Jean asked.

"I was swatted by the Female Titan like a fly. I'm fine just minor cuts and scrapes." Kyra informed.

They looked at the blood that stained her back before nodding.

"I'm glad you're okay." Armin said as Jean nodded.

"Yeah, the same goes for you two and the others." Kyra said as her eyes glanced at all the bodies being gathered.

The two walked away to help leaving Kyra on her horse.

Kyra watched numbly as bodies were lined up and wrapped with cloth before they were carried onto a wagon stacked on top of one another. She watched as Armin and Jean lifted the bodies into the wagon talking about how this is part of their job that they will never get used to.

Kyra was forced to limited movement since her injuries. As she moved she felt a slight pain lining her side. She glanced at the area to see swelling and bruising around her rib cage. She sighed knowing that she had cracked a rib.

They weren't wrong, besides the danger of being a Scout this was a part of the Scouts that if not all, damn near all hated. The gathering and collecting of the dead to bring home to the unsuspecting and hopeful folks waiting within the walls for their return.

It was something that Kyra didn't have to worry about. She had no one waiting for her to return back within the walls. But the same couldn't be said for every one of the soldiers that they lost today. These men and women had families waiting for them.

Her mind flickered back to Petra, Eld, Gunther, and Oruo. The memories of them and the flashback of each of their deaths.  The images of their dead bodies appeared in her mind as she continued watching the bodies pile up. The Scouts had taken a massive hit on this expedition.

Kyra looked at the bodies solemnly as each one was lifted up and stacked into wagons.

She sat on her horse looking at the sky, she clenched her fist tightly. They saw. I know they did. There's no keeping it. It's only a matter of time until it gets brought up. Damn it!

...

The Scouts began moving out heading back to the wall. Kyra rode beside Armin and Jean.

She glanced back as a voice screamed. "Wait!"

She glanced at two Scouts on horseback running from two Titans.

"Heads up! We've got company!" The other man shouted.

"Titans!"

Red smoke shot into the air.

Kyra glanced back hearing the yells of the soldier as he got captured. The Titan came running towards them quickly.

"It's about to be right on top of us!" Armin commented in worry.

"Looks like we've got no choice but to fight!" Jean said.

"No." Kyra said flatly.

"Ground's too flat to engage ODM gear. And not only that--We'll soon be outnumbered." Armin informed looking over to see more Titans coming.

Jean sighed before looking to Armin and Kyra. "Perfect. Then what do you suggest we do, geniuses?" Jean asked.

"The only thing we can." Armin answered.

"Drop the dead. I can't move well enough to take them." Kyra said before moving to the wagon. "Drop the bodies. The wagon is too slow with all that weight. You won't be able to outrun it like this." Kyra called out to Peer.

"Are you crazy? Just who the hell do you think you are to make that call?" Peer yelled out.

"It's the only option at this point. They're dead, body or no body. This will not change the fact that they are still dead, period. And you'll join them too if you can't learn to let go! We've lost more than enough men, so let it go! Let it go, damn it!" Kyra shouted.

"We're done! It's gaining on us! I'll jump behind the bastard and distract him! Give you a chance to put some distance--" The soldier said.

"And do what die like the rest of them?! You damned fool, getting sentimental on these matters right now, won't save your conscience if your dead, too! You know what you have to do. So I'll tell you once more, if you value your life, toss the bodies!" Kyra yelled out harshly.

"She's right. Don't bother. You've got to jettison the extra weight. Dump the bodies." Captain Levi said falling back to the side of the wagon.

"B-B-But, sir! "

"Do you know how many corpses we've already left behind? These aren't special. Dump them! Consider it their last service to the cause." Captain Levi stated.

"Are we doing this? We can't seriously be doing this!" The soldier shouted out fighting his morals.

"Damn it. I'm sorry, there's just no other way!" Captain Levi said referring to his injured leg.

Kyra gritted her teeth moving through the burning on her side before jumping on to the wagon. "Tch, I'll do it. You're obviously fighting against your morals. So, I'll spare you the emotional torment and do it myself. You won't be the one to blame for this, I will. Just stay the hell outta my way. You can hate me later once I save your asses!" Kyra shouted at the two starting to dump the bodies.

The men around her gasped in shock with wide eyes as she shouted out. The bodies fell off the wagon allowing for the wagon to speed up from the heavy weight being removed.

"We're losing him!" The soldier called out in relief.

Kyra stood up and jumped back on her horse grunting as she held her side. They continued to move forward. She rode next to Jean and Armin who remained silent.

...

They made a stop to regroup. Kyra pet her horse before stopping as she spotted the blood of the fallen on her hand. She paused staring at it. The angry and rushed footsteps could be heard coming straight for her. She pet her horse muttering, "Stand down, Enzo." She ordered to the horse.

She turned around only to be grabbed by her collar by the soldier from earlier, who gritted his teeth with tears.

"You calloused cold-hearted bitch! How could you?! You probably enjoy seeing people suffer! Is that it, you get off on misery and despair?" The man yelled out pulling Kyra off her feet as the man snarled seething as he punched her repeatedly.

Jean stood up seeing this as Mikasa and Armin followed.

"Hey, man! Knock it off!" Jean yelled out.

"Let her go!" Mikasa growled out pulling out her swords.

"Stop!" Armin shouted.

Kyra remained looking at the soldier as blood fell from her nose and mouth. After the tenth punch she grabbed his fist.

"What's going on here?" Captain Levi demanded.

Both ignored him as they continued to gaze at each other one with cold eyes and the other full of pure hatred.

"As I said you can hate me all you want, later. You obviously couldn't do it. So I made the choice for you. I did it for you. If that makes me the calloused and heartless bitch you see me as, then so fucking be it. At the end of the day, when we get back and you aren't happy that you are alive. That you aren't grateful that you get to see your loved ones, then come find me. Find me and take all your aggression, frustration, anguish, and sorrow out on me! I won't fight back, I'll take it, because it's the burden I chose to bear for saving your life!" Kyra spat out at the man.

"Drop her, now. That's an order." Captain Levi said sternly.

The man gritted his teeth closing his eyes as his grip on Kyra loosened. Kyra landed on her feet before walking away from the group unfazed by the events that just happened.

She whistled causing Enzo to follow after her.

"K-Kyra, wait!" Armin stood up to run after her.

Jean stopped him, "Just let her be for right now. Give her some space." Jean said softly.

Armin looked down in worry before he sighed nodding. "Right."

"Let's move 'em out!" An Elite yelled out.

...

Kyra walked through the gate pulling her horse along numbly. She continued to look ahead as her eyes remained void of emotion.

She could hear the shocked whispers from the crowd that gathered to watch them.

"Am I miscounting, or are there fewer of 'em than when they left?"

"No, there's a lot fewer."

"Must've been a bad one."

"I don't get it. They were all piss and vinegar this morning. They're already back?"

"Hell, why bother leavin' in the first place?"

"No idea. I'd say by the looks on their faces they hoped to be gone longer. Our taxes hard at work, ladies and gentlemen. Bravo."

Kyra clenched the rein tighter as she looked up to the sky.

Kyra continued to move forward passing a man who ran to Captain Levi. "Excuse me, Captain Levi?"

Kyra could hear the enraged and disgruntled shout aimed at Commander Erwin.

"Give us some answers, damn you! We have a right!"

"How many lives were lost on this mission? Was it worth it? Was is really worth it?"

"You think the last thing going through their minds was "for the good of humanity?""

It never ends. The prospects of life and death are just an endless cycle. A never ending cycle that does not discriminate because all that live are forced to undergo this cycle...until they die.

...

The causalities incurred during the Scout Regiment's latest excursion beyond the wall were profound. So much so, that what little public favor they still held was all but crushed.

Within hours of their return, Erwin and the battle-weary survivors were called to the capital. The Scouts' custody of Eren and Kyra were summarily revoked.
